Description: 1) Anonymous users can view message content, the administrator opens the " Allow anonymous users to comment" feature in case you can leave a message. 2) has been logged users can post, edit, and delete their own comments. 3) administrators with administrative user (for example, add and delete users), Management Message (deleted and reply to messages), management Guestbook (such as setting the paging message Show number of records, turn on/off the anonymous user and logged in user comments, etc. ) 4) must use N-tier architecture (such as three-tier structure of the presentation layer/business logic/data access layer), using a custom DBHelper class, the interface must be used CSS+DIV for layout, you need to use the calibration controls (eg RequiredFieldValidator) . 5) back-end database design their own needs (which needs to include a message' s ip address, message date, message content, etc.), you must use the stored procedure. 6) Development Environment VS 2005+SQL Server2
To Search:
File list (Check if you may need any files):
留言板\DB\GuestBook.mdf
......\..\GuestBook_log.LDF
......\GB\GB.BLL\bin\Debug\GB.BLL.dll
......\..\......\...\.....\GB.BLL.pdb
......\..\......\...\.....\GB.DAL.dll
......\..\......\...\.....\GB.DAL.pdb
......\..\......\...\.....\GB.Models.dll
......\..\......\...\.....\GB.Models.pdb
......\..\......\GB.BLL.csproj
......\..\......\MessageManager.cs
......\..\......\obj\Debug\GB.BLL.dll
......\..\......\...\.....\GB.BLL.pdb
......\..\......\...\.....\Refactor\GB.BLL.dll
......\..\......\...\.....\ResolveAssemblyReference.cache
......\..\......\...\GB.BLL.csproj.FileListAbsolute.txt
......\..\......\Properties\AssemblyInfo.cs
......\..\......\UserMsnager.cs
......\..\......\VTune\GB.vpj
......\..\...DAL\bin\Debug\GB.DAL.dll
......\..\......\...\.....\GB.DAL.pdb
......\..\......\...\.....\GB.Models.dll
......\..\......\...\.....\GB.Models.pdb
......\..\......\DBHelp.cs
......\..\......\GB.DAL.csproj
......\..\......\MessageService.cs
......\..\......\obj\Debug\GB.DAL.dll
......\..\......\...\.....\GB.DAL.pdb
......\..\......\...\.....\Refactor\GB.DAL.dll
......\..\......\...\.....\ResolveAssemblyReference.cache
......\..\......\...\GB.DAL.csproj.FileListAbsolute.txt
......\..\......\Properties\AssemblyInfo.cs
......\..\......\UserService.cs
......\..\......\VTune\GB.vpj
......\..\...Models\bin\Debug\GB.Models.dll
......\..\.........\...\.....\GB.Models.pdb
......\..\.........\GB.Models.csproj
......\..\.........\Message.cs
......\..\.........\obj\Debug\GB.Models.dll
......\..\.........\...\.....\GB.Models.pdb
......\..\.........\...\.....\Refactor\GB.Models.dll
......\..\.........\...\GB.Models.csproj.FileListAbsolute.txt
......\..\.........\Properties\AssemblyInfo.cs
......\..\.........\User.cs
......\..\.........\VTune\GB.vpj
......\..\GB.sln
......\..\GB.suo
......\..\...Web\Admin.aspx
......\..\......\Admin.aspx.cs
......\..\......\.pp_Code\GBItem.cs
......\..\......\....Data\GuestBook.mdf
......\..\......\........\GuestBook_log.LDF
......\..\......\Bin\GB.BLL.dll
......\..\......\...\GB.BLL.pdb
......\..\......\...\GB.DAL.dll
......\..\......\...\GB.DAL.pdb
......\..\......\...\GB.Models.dll
......\..\......\...\GB.Models.pdb
......\..\......\css\StyleSheet.css
......\..\......\Default.aspx
......\..\......\Default.aspx.cs
......\..\......\imgs\10.jpg
......\..\......\....\200709151757864.jpg
......\..\......\....\200709159728335.jpg
......\..\......\....\2959131_162157694239_2.jpg
......\..\......\....\2960863_083618003141_2.jpg
......\..\......\....\5633454_102850374302_2.jpg
......\..\......\....\6040329_093449752000_2.jpg
......\..\......\....\7743654_082909527195_2.jpg
......\..\......\Login.aspx
......\..\......\Login.aspx.cs
......\..\......\ManageMessage.aspx
......\..\......\ManageMessage.aspx.cs
......\..\......\OwnPage.aspx
......\..\......\OwnPage.aspx.cs
......\..\......\Register.aspx
......\..\......\Register.aspx.cs
......\..\......\Web.Config
......\..\GD.suo
......\readme.txt
......\留言板.doc
......\GB\GB.BLL\obj\Debug\Refactor
......\..\......\...\.....\TempPE
......\..\...DAL\obj\Debug\Refactor
......\..\......\...\.....\TempPE
......\..\...Models\obj\Debug\Refactor
......\..\.........\...\.....\TempPE
......\..\...BLL\bin\Debug
......\..\......\obj\Debug
......\..\...DAL\bin\Debug
......\..\......\obj\Debug
......\..\...Models\bin\Debug
......\..\.........\obj\Debug
......\..\...BLL\bin
......\..\......\obj
......\..\......\Properties
......\..\......\VTune
......\..\...DAL\bin
......\..\......\obj
......\..\......\Properties
......\..\......\VTune